Greater Montréal neighbourhoods ranked by Southeast Asian population
986 Greater Montréal neighbourhoods with published 2021 Census profiles, ranked by Southeast Asian population. The highest are Saint-Michel (northwest) (13.4%), François-Perrault (southwest 2) (13.4%), Sainte-Lucie (east-southeast) (12.9%). The lowest are Tétreaultville (east) (0.0%), Maisonneuve (east) (0.0%), Hochelaga (east-southeast) (0.0%). Communities with fewer than 500 residents are marked † and left out of these headline figures, because rates over so small a base are unreliable.
Greater Montréal as a whole: 1.5%
